Class Experience

Exposure is very important when learning a second language. This class will be about 75% in Spanish.  Students will hear vocabulary  words associated with the class theme, Family, about 8-10 words per class.  As they hear and learn new words they will be asked to draw pictures to match the words.  As they are drawing, I will use the words in everyday phrases to put them into context. Students will be encouraged to participate and repeat words but will never be forced if they're not ready to speak in Spanish.  Prior Spanish language exposure is not necessary as the class is meant to be for beginners.
